Machine Learning Infrastructure Engineer

Cupertino, CA 95014
  • Job Code
    200196983
Summary

Summary

Posted: Oct 7, 2020

Weekly Hours: 40

Role Number:200196983

Imagine what you could do at Apple! Everyday, new ideas have a way of becoming extraordinary products, services,...Summary

Summary

Posted: Oct 7, 2020

Weekly Hours: 40

Role Number:200196983

Imagine what you could do at Apple! Everyday, new ideas have a way of becoming extraordinary products, services, and customer experiences very quickly. Do you bring passion and dedication to your job? If so, we are looking for individuals like you. The Interactive Media Group (IMG) is at the center of audio, video and graphics support in Apple's innovative products, including the AirPods, HomePod, Mac, iPhone, iPad, Apple Watch, Apple TV,
IMG's Audio team provides the audio foundation for various high profile features like Game Audio, Siri, FaceTime, media capture, playback and API's for third party developers to enrich our platforms. The team is looking for talented engineers who are passionate about building audio features and products for millions of customers and care about overall user experience. You will revolutionize the audio experience for game and future audio technologies. The team is looking for a highly motivated and hardworking software engineer to build and maintain our machine learning R&D workflow.

Key Qualifications

  • 3+ years experience in software development, including machine learning workflows, from data processing to performance analysis
  • Experience in building scalable software operating on large datasets and with a high degree of task parallelism
  • Software programming in Python, C, C++
  • Experience with machine learning tools such as TensorFlow, Keras, PyTorch
  • Knowledge of machine learning concepts and ability to implement techniques such as curriculum learning and neural architecture search
  • Knowledge of audio technologies, concepts and theory, signal processing

Description

As part of the audio team, you will own the machine learning workflows and collaborate with researchers and developers in creating state-of-the art audio processing and inference engines. Among the various responsibilities for the position you will:
Design, build and maintain machine learning workflows
Work closely with researchers and developers to implement, refactor and integrate ML-DSP algorithms into the workflows
Adopt company-wide tools and integrate them into the workflows
Create and maintain documentation for the tools and manage version control
Manage data pipelines
Work with all levels of engineers from junior to Apple veteran

Education & Experience

M.S. in CS, Industry experience or equivalent.

Additional Requirements

  • Expertise in software architecture and API design is a plus
  • Experience with version control management is a plus
  • Experience with installing/handling Python packages is a plus
  • Excellent communication skills and a passion for solving problems


Before you go...

Our free job seeker tools include alerts for new jobs, saving your favorites, optimized job matching, and more! Just enter your email below.

Share this job:

Machine Learning Infrastructure Engineer

Apple, Inc.
Cupertino, CA 95014

Join us to start saving your Favorite Jobs!

Sign In Create Account